export const redeemPrintingV2Bid = async ({
connection,
wallet,
store,
auction,
}: RedeemBidParams): Promise<RedeemBidResponse> => {
const bidder = wallet.publicKey;
const {
data: { bidState },
} = await Auction.load(connection, auction);
const auctionManagerPDA = await AuctionManager.getPDA(auction);
const manager = await AuctionManager.load(connection, auctionManagerPDA);
const vault = await Vault.load(connection, manager.data.vault);
const auctionExtendedPDA = await AuctionExtended.getPDA(vault.pubkey);
const [safetyDepositBox] = await vault.getSafetyDepositBoxes(connection);
const originalMint = new PublicKey(safetyDepositBox.data.tokenMint);
const safetyDepositTokenStore = new PublicKey(safetyDepositBox.data.store);
const bidderMetaPDA = await BidderMetadata.getPDA(auction, bidder);
const bidRedemptionPDA = await getBidRedemptionPDA(auction, bidderMetaPDA);
const safetyDepositConfigPDA = await SafetyDepositConfig.getPDA(
auctionManagerPDA,
safetyDepositBox.pubkey,
);
const { mint, createMintTx, createAssociatedTokenAccountTx, mintToTx, recipient } =
await prepareTokenAccountAndMintTxs(connection, wallet.publicKey);
const newMint = mint.publicKey;
const newMetadataPDA = await Metadata.getPDA(newMint);
const newEditionPDA = await Edition.getPDA(newMint);
const metadataPDA = await Metadata.getPDA(originalMint);
const masterEditionPDA = await MasterEdition.getPDA(originalMint);
const masterEdition = await MasterEdition.load(connection, masterEditionPDA);
const prizeTrackingTicketPDA = await PrizeTrackingTicket.getPDA(auctionManagerPDA, originalMint);
let prizeTrackingTicket: PrizeTrackingTicket;
// this account doesn't exist when we do redeem for the first time
try {
prizeTrackingTicket = await PrizeTrackingTicket.load(connection, prizeTrackingTicketPDA);
} catch (e) {
prizeTrackingTicket = null;
}
const winIndex = bidState.getWinnerIndex(bidder.toBase58()) || 0;
const editionOffset = getEditionOffset(winIndex);
const editionBase = prizeTrackingTicket?.data.supplySnapshot || masterEdition.data.supply;
const desiredEdition = editionBase.add(editionOffset);
const editionMarkerPDA = await EditionMarker.getPDA(originalMint, desiredEdition);
// checking if edition marker is taken
try {
const editionMarker = await EditionMarker.load(connection, editionMarkerPDA);
const isEditionTaken = editionMarker.data.editionTaken(desiredEdition.toNumber());
if (isEditionTaken) {
throw new Error('The edition is already taken');
}
} catch (e) {
// it's not. continue
}
const txBatch = await getRedeemPrintingV2BidTransactions({
bidder,
bidderMeta: bidderMetaPDA,
store,
vault: vault.pubkey,
destination: recipient,
auction,
auctionExtended: auctionExtendedPDA,
auctionManager: auctionManagerPDA,
safetyDepositTokenStore,
safetyDeposit: safetyDepositBox.pubkey,
bidRedemption: bidRedemptionPDA,
safetyDepositConfig: safetyDepositConfigPDA,
metadata: metadataPDA,
newMint,
newMetadata: newMetadataPDA,
newEdition: newEditionPDA,
masterEdition: masterEditionPDA,
editionMarker: editionMarkerPDA,
prizeTrackingTicket: prizeTrackingTicketPDA,
editionOffset,
winIndex: new BN(winIndex),
});
txBatch.addSigner(mint);
txBatch.addBeforeTransaction(createMintTx);
txBatch.addBeforeTransaction(createAssociatedTokenAccountTx);
txBatch.addBeforeTransaction(mintToTx);
const txId = await sendTransaction({
connection,
wallet,
txs: txBatch.toTransactions(),
signers: txBatch.signers,
});
return { txId };
};
